This role covers various functions in order to fulfil orders as per customer specifications and standards.
Working hours: 07:00am - 6:30pm on a 4 on, 4 off shift pattern.
The Position
- Trim, peel, bag and pack onions and other products as guided by your Line Manager and as per customer specifications.
- Report any issues with machinery, product quality or packaging issues to your Line Manager.
